    I'm guessing that the photos were converted to png files. In the photo page do not add any enhancement to the photos, borders, strokes, drop shadow, reflection, or anything like that. That should keep them as jpgs. Also use web safe fonts for the titles and they will remain as text instead of getting converted to png files. Here are some tips I've learned from this forum:
    1 - do not use and frames or borders, etc. around photos.
    2 - don't use any reflections.
    3 - create your own navigation bar with linked text* and turn of the iWeb Navigation bar. The nav bar is all png based.
    4 - use only the web safe fonts from the Font pane.
    5 - do not use drop shadow on fonts.
    6 - turn off smart quotes.
    The above will reduce the number and size of files associated with a web page quite a bit. Photos with fancy frames and reflections can generate a thumbnail png of around 110KB whereas the plain version will be a jpg of only 28KB. Although it doesn't sound like a lot, it will speed up loading of the page and be more darkside (i.e. PC) friendly.
    Run a test with a test site and publish to a folder. Then follow the hints above and publish to another folder and compare folders.
    *Put your linked text directly under the Navigation bar. Then turn off the nav bar in the Inspector window. The nav bar will disappear and the linked text will move up to the top of the page.

    This is from iPhoto Help:
    In iPhoto, select the photos, albums, or video clips you want to burn to a disc.
    Choose File > Export.
    In the Export Photos window, click File Export, and then select your options.For best results, choose JPEG, Maximum, and Full Size. For more information, see Export a photo.
    When you’re ready, click Export, and export the photos to a folder on your computer.
    When the export is finished, quit iPhoto.
    Click the Finder icon in the Dock, and then insert a CD-RW disc or a blank CD-R or DVD-R disc into your drive.
    Drag the folder that contains your exported photos to the disc’s icon.
    When the files have been copied, choose File > Burn Disc, and then click Burn.

    In your Sharing panel, did you go into "Options" and check the box for sharing via SMB?
    Then from XP you should be able to reach the Mac via //(ip# or DNS name)/
    and you should see the available shares.

    In iTunes for Windows, in order to view HD content, both the display hardware (computer screen, LCD, external monitor, and so on) and video card driver must support HDCP.
    Note: Depending on your computer's hardware limitations, you may be unable to purchase, rent, or view HD content from the iTunes Store. If you are trying to view HD video on an external display, the display must have a digital connection (DVI, DisplayPort, or HDMI) and support HDCP.
